Dubai Sports City is the world’s first purpose-built sports city. Set on 50 million square feet of land within the Dubailand development, Dubai Sports City will feature four magnificent stadia: a 60,000 seat multi-purpose outdoor stadium, a 25,000 capacity cricket stadium, a 10,000 seat multi-purpose indoor arena, and a field hockey venue for 5,000 spectators.
A wide range of sporting events take place throughout the season in the UAE bringing the world's top-class sportsmen and women to the country. The US$1 million Dubai Tennis Championships attracts many of the world's top male and female players to the city's impressive Tennis Stadium. The tournament incorporates both men's ATP Tour and Women's WTA Tour events.
When it comes to money, the Dubai World Cup at the Nad Al Sheba Racecourse is the richest horse race in the world. Horses have long been an intergral part of life in the UAE where some of the best equestrian facilities are located. The mile-and-a-quarter group-one race for four year olds and above offers an incredible US$6 million prize fund, with US$3.6 million going to the winner.
